• Home
  • History
  • Annotate
  • Raw
  • Download
  • only in /netgear-R7000-V1.0.7.12_1.2.5/components/opensource/linux/linux-2.6.36/drivers/gpu/drm/i915/

Lines Matching refs:dev_priv

73 	drm_i915_private_t *dev_priv = dev->dev_private;
80 lock = &dev_priv->mm.active_list_lock;
81 head = &dev_priv->render_ring.active_list;
85 head = &dev_priv->mm.inactive_list;
89 head = &dev_priv->mm.flushing_list;
177 drm_i915_private_t *dev_priv = dev->dev_private;
181 list_for_each_entry(gem_request, &dev_priv->render_ring.request_list,
194 drm_i915_private_t *dev_priv = dev->dev_private;
196 if (dev_priv->render_ring.status_page.page_addr != NULL) {
198 i915_get_gem_seqno(dev, &dev_priv->render_ring));
203 dev_priv->mm.waiting_gem_seqno);
204 seq_printf(m, "IRQ sequence: %d\n", dev_priv->mm.irq_gem_seqno);
213 drm_i915_private_t *dev_priv = dev->dev_private;
247 atomic_read(&dev_priv->irq_received));
248 if (dev_priv->render_ring.status_page.page_addr != NULL) {
250 i915_get_gem_seqno(dev, &dev_priv->render_ring));
255 dev_priv->mm.waiting_gem_seqno);
257 dev_priv->mm.irq_gem_seqno);
265 drm_i915_private_t *dev_priv = dev->dev_private;
268 seq_printf(m, "Reserved fences = %d\n", dev_priv->fence_reg_start);
269 seq_printf(m, "Total fences = %d\n", dev_priv->num_fence_regs);
270 for (i = 0; i < dev_priv->num_fence_regs; i++) {
271 struct drm_gem_object *obj = dev_priv->fence_regs[i].obj;
300 drm_i915_private_t *dev_priv = dev->dev_private;
304 hws = (volatile u32 *)dev_priv->render_ring.status_page.page_addr;
333 drm_i915_private_t *dev_priv = dev->dev_private;
338 spin_lock(&dev_priv->mm.active_list_lock);
340 list_for_each_entry(obj_priv, &dev_priv->render_ring.active_list,
347 spin_unlock(&dev_priv->mm.active_list_lock);
358 spin_unlock(&dev_priv->mm.active_list_lock);
367 drm_i915_private_t *dev_priv = dev->dev_private;
371 if (!dev_priv->render_ring.gem_object) {
376 virt = dev_priv->render_ring.virtual_start;
378 for (off = 0; off < dev_priv->render_ring.size; off += 4) {
390 drm_i915_private_t *dev_priv = dev->dev_private;
398 seq_printf(m, "RingSize : %08lx\n", dev_priv->render_ring.size);
438 drm_i915_private_t *dev_priv = dev->dev_private;
443 spin_lock_irqsave(&dev_priv->error_lock, flags);
444 if (!dev_priv->first_error) {
449 error = dev_priv->first_error;
523 spin_unlock_irqrestore(&dev_priv->error_lock, flags);
532 drm_i915_private_t *dev_priv = dev->dev_private;
544 drm_i915_private_t *dev_priv = dev->dev_private;
562 drm_i915_private_t *dev_priv = dev->dev_private;
584 drm_i915_private_t *dev_priv = dev->dev_private;
600 drm_i915_private_t *dev_priv = dev->dev_private;
633 drm_i915_private_t *dev_priv = dev->dev_private;
644 switch (dev_priv->no_fbc_reason) {
675 drm_i915_private_t *dev_priv = dev->dev_private;
695 drm_i915_private_t *dev_priv = dev->dev_private;
698 temp = i915_mch_val(dev_priv);
699 chipset = i915_chipset_val(dev_priv);
700 gfx = i915_gfx_val(dev_priv);
714 drm_i915_private_t *dev_priv = dev->dev_private;
736 drm_i915_private_t *dev_priv = dev->dev_private;
742 atomic_read(&dev_priv->mm.wedged));
754 drm_i915_private_t *dev_priv = dev->dev_private;
771 atomic_set(&dev_priv->mm.wedged, val);
773 DRM_WAKEUP(&dev_priv->irq_queue);
774 queue_work(dev_priv->wq, &dev_priv->error_work);